City of Ryde libraries are community spaces where everyone can share the excitement of discovery! You can use our libraries to read for pleasure, study, meet new people, experience other cultures, look for jobs, learn a new skill or share your skills.
Membership is free and anyone who lives, works or plays in the City of Ryde is eligible to join.

The Home Library Service is a free delivery service provided to those who are unable to get to the library due to illness or disability.
If an item you need is not available at any of the Ryde libraries, you can request a copy through the Inter Library Loans service.
